PSAT Math Multiple-Choice Question 754: Answer and Explanation
Question: 754
How many more kilograms (to the nearest hundredth) will a 2 cubic meter balloon that is filled with air weigh than an identical balloon that is filled with helium, given that helium has a density of and air has a density of
- A. 0.21
- B. 1.02
- C. 1.38
- D. 2.04
Correct Answer: D
Explanation:
(D) The weight of the balloon itself is irrelevant since the balloon is identical in both situations.
1.2 - 0.179 = 1.021 is the difference in density between the two balloons. Since you have a 2 cubic meter balloon, simply multiply 1.021 × 2 to give approximately 2.04.
